    This car was for sale in December, 2003, at Silicon Valley Auto Group; silver/charcoal, carbon fiber trim and race seats, shields, modular wheels, red calipers, 2K miles.

    Then it was on eBay on 19 February 2007 through St. Louis Motor Sports, LLC, silver/black, 4,380 miles, $205,000.

    This is/was a Jon Walton car, and it was built after the first few 575Ms, so it's possible - though I have no proof - that it left the factory with those headlights. But irrespective of the ownership provenance, it's more likely that the headlights were added after market.

    I saw it in June, 2008, at the 2008 Le Belle Macchine d'Italia concorso in Skytop, PA.
